> > You could try to debug it :).
>
>   Ya never know, I might just do that.  Is it worth rebuilding with
> --enable-debugging at configure time ?  I dunno how much worthwhile that
> will actually give me....
>
IIRC, --enable-debugging just adds more verbose logging (primarily
strace) and enables CYGWIN_DEBUG functionality.  So, it is probably not
worth it.  Just debug with the version you've got.
